Quick question
When using the CMUcam for the boe-bot usb version, is it possible to use other simple hardware such as IR sensors or photoresistors?
There is a special pin set for the camera or other appmods, but the holes are labled the same letters and numbers as the I/O pins for the breadboard.
Does anyone know if it is possible to use the camera with other hardware, or does the camera use up all of the pins?

Of which CMUcam do you refer? I know of three variations.
Have you a manual/schematic for your CMUcam? If so, the pins it uses should be identified on that.
How are you connecting the CMUcam to your Stamp board?
Assuming the Parallax CMUcam, the schematic is the past page in the manual (http://parallax.com/Portals/0/Downloads/docs/prod/robo/cmucamman.pdf) and the diagram on pages 6 & 7 suggests that the interface of the CMUcam to the Stamp will be thru a 3-pin serial interface.
